Business view web console missing in update 4

Post by ashleyw »

Hi,

I saw update 4 had been released for Veeam One, so I applied it and now there appears to be no web console on port 1340 any more?
Surely this is not the case?
I have now rolled back.
Prior to update 4 (for years) we were using categorisations to allow for internal recharge to our various teams.
The business view was available view a simple easy to use web view and we were able to give internal teams access to that web view that greatly assisted in minimising sprawl etc.
After applying update 4, the web console on 1340 is not now available, so exactly where is that same functionality now so that we can let our teams know, should we reapply update 4?
We need this is a web view format to avoid any of the users having to install products on their desktops along with the same export format as this is part of one of our accounting processes.
It was the workspace view that was particularly useful as teams could look at the VMs categorised to their P&L code for reconciling against the recharge summaries from our accountants.

Please advise.

Re: Business view web console missing in update 4

Post by MichaelCade » 1 person likes this post

Hi Ashley,

The Business View module has been moved to within the monitor console. The major underpinning aspect of this change also includes a single wizard to create the categorisations.

A pain point was that one object could only be part of one group, this is now resolved and allows for objects to span multiple groups to better define the business requirements.

Finally, is the ability to not only pull data from the virtual infrastructure but also able to send data back in the form of tags. The ability to pull already virtualised tags from vSphere or Hyper-V into Business View and report and monitor against those, but also the ability to use the categorisation to create new tags based on specifics such as CPU, Memory or location.

All existing groups and catagories will still be present in the new view, this will now be found within the Veeam ONE monitor console.

Here you will find all additional new functionality within the user guide - https://helpcenter.veeam.com/docs/one/m ... l?ver=95u4

Re: Business view web console missing in update 4

Post by Shestakov »

Hi Ashley,
As Michael mentioned all categories and groups will remain after an update.
We also added more categorization parameters and made it possible to categorize computers protected by Veeam Agent.
And yes, since all functionality is moved to Monitor, web version is not available.
We need this is a web view format to avoid any of the users having to install products on their desktops along with the same export format as this is part of one of our accounting processes.
It was the workspace view that was particularly useful as teams could look at the VMs categorised to their P&L code for reconciling against the recharge summaries from our accountants.
So the use case is to check objects categorization and manually adjust it if needed? For this you need to install light-weight Veeam ONE Monitor client.

Re: Business view web console missing in update 4

Post by Shestakov »

...being able to give a simple URL to a project team and for that project team to have visibility of the resources that the project was consuming.
Could you specify what kind of information is needed to be shared.
You can create custom dashboards using Business View groups as a scope in Veeam ONE Reporter (which is still web-based) and share the dashboards with the project managers.
